IT'S ALIVE
all 4 slots are working, only the forth marquee light works
to do list
replace marquee light
replace flyback
clean up the coin mech, coins wont drop
new buttons
new joysticks
new cp overlay
sand and paint the metal parts
get laminate for the sides
vinyl decals
more games
